You can buy the live feeds on Realplayer (not sure how much it costs) or you can watch each individual episode on several sites live. There's usually links provided in the episode discussion threads. If you dont fancy staying up till 2/3 o'clock, the episodes are posted around in several places the following day, Youtube being the most obvious.
